Output 39efe72c87a122ecef28ca3a50b83268e3480a63650bdeff5409a8e17f878f26:2

value
1669608
script pubkey
OP_0 OP_PUSHBYTES_20 6bd20c3f529bb3b46fd01377467ab20e11d7ada8
address
ltc1qd0fqc06jnwemgm7szdm5v74jpcga0tdg3zu7ht
transaction
39efe72c87a122ecef28ca3a50b83268e3480a63650bdeff5409a8e17f878f26
spent
true